Dawn, LSI Foster Care and Adoption Service Area Leader What You'll Do The AdoptionPermanency Support Caseworker is a specialized role that is responsible to work with children and their adoptive, kinship, or sub-gaurdianship family to assure stability and prevent disruption. Successful completion of work will require use of assessment and diagnostic skills, varying treatment modalities and behavior interventions, crisis intervention, information and coordination of treatment services (case management), arranging for recreation and respite, other supportive activities, and advocacy. The AdoptionPermanency Support Caseworker will be expected to complete job responsibilities by traveling by car to client homes, at an office or other community settings, or by telephone. These activities may occur during normal business hours, after hours, or on weekends. What You'll Need Qualified applicants will have a Bachelor's degree in social work, human services, behavioral sciences or a related field and a minimum of 1 year experience in child welfare services.
